The Contest and Rules:

Given a 9-by-9 grid divided into nine 3-by-3 regions, place the numbers 1 through 9 into the 81 grids with no number repeated on any row, column, or 3-by-3 region. The puzzle is started with some filled-in (“the givens”) numbers (see example below). The job is to fill in the rest of the boxes. The number of the givens will determine the level of difficulty. Fewer is the givens, the harder is the puzzle. The contest will get harder as it progresses through the rounds. The prelimary round will be easier than Super; and Super will be easier than Final. Who advances in each round is determined by comparing the number of correct entry. Each round is given 15-30 mins.
